package controller
import (
kapi "k8s.io/kubernetes/pkg/api"
"k8s.io/kubernetes/pkg/api/errors"
kclient "k8s.io/kubernetes/pkg/client/unversioned"
osclient "github.com/openshift/origin/pkg/client"
projectutil "github.com/openshift/origin/pkg/project/util"
)
// NamespaceController is responsible for participating in Kubernetes Namespace termination
// Use the NamespaceControllerFactory to create this controller.
type NamespaceController struct {
// Client is an OpenShift client.
Client osclient.Interface
// KubeClient is a Kubernetes client.
KubeClient kclient.Interface
}
// fatalError is an error which can't be retried.
type fatalError string
// Error implements the interface for errors
func (e fatalError) Error() string { return "fatal error handling namespace: " + string(e) }
// Handle processes a namespace and deletes content in origin if its terminating
func (c *NamespaceController) Handle(namespace *kapi.Namespace) (err error) {
// if namespace is not terminating, ignore it
if namespace.Status.Phase != kapi.NamespaceTerminating {
return nil
}
// if we already processed this namespace, ignore it
if projectutil.Finalized(namespace) {
return nil
}
// there may still be content for us to remove
err = deleteAllContent(c.Client, namespace.Name)
if err != nil {
return err
}
// we have removed content, so mark it finalized by us
_, err = projectutil.Finalize(c.KubeClient, namespace)
if err != nil {
return err
}
return nil
}
// deleteAllContent will purge all content in openshift in the specified namespace
func deleteAllContent(client osclient.Interface, namespace string) (err error) {
err = deleteBuildConfigs(client, namespace)
if err != nil {
return err
}
err = deleteBuilds(client, namespace)
if err != nil {
return err
}
err = deleteDeploymentConfigs(client, namespace)
if err != nil {
return err
}
err = deleteImageStreams(client, namespace)
if err != nil {
return err
}
err = deletePolicies(client, namespace)
if err != nil {
return err
}
err = deletePolicyBindings(client, namespace)
if err != nil {
return err
}
err = deleteRoleBindings(client, namespace)
if err != nil {
return err
}
err = deleteRoles(client, namespace)
if err != nil {
return err
}
err = deleteRoutes(client, namespace)
if err != nil {
return err
}
err = deleteTemplates(client, namespace)
if err != nil {
return err
}
return nil
}
